Transaction 59fe820c707a14a66713ed2edc136024a062574224791a82cf347b3764954df3

1 Input
2 Outputs
  • 59fe820c707a14a66713ed2edc136024a062574224791a82cf347b3764954df3:0
  • value  2560000000
    address  13tnyYR2fqcXuRpw8ghMTW2oUAp78Hwu5b
  • 59fe820c707a14a66713ed2edc136024a062574224791a82cf347b3764954df3:1
  • value  2963370811
    address  1DiRTqFSRxHRaCNRqk9RDHpcFDKYoBB4PU